Rough diamond exports from Russia amounted to 22,844,000 carats in volume and US$1.529 billion in value, for the period of January to October 2008. The maximum exports from Russia were received by the European Union, amounting to 16,326,000 carats or US$1.129 billion. The EU accounted for around 71 percent of Russian rough exports. %% Rough diamond imports into Russia amounted to 215,151 carats in volume and US$30.75 million in volume from EU countries in the nine months of 2008. The imports in Q3 of 2008, amounted to 151,890 carats, which increased by more than two times the imports in the first six months of 2008, which were 73,289 carats. Owing to the economic slowdown and reduced demand, the country is not hopeful to cross its total rough exports of last year, which amounted to US$2.37 billion.
